Output 0508133e74cc0c67e147f8e9435f04b366e99822329a48383e1a318e4581bafa:0

value
1851697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bb221cb5d0cb8dce18769048bd1eea60058feb8 OP_EQUAL
address
3BWTcu58nfTFUvpwMXbroeCvRFoKgq7PUp
transaction
0508133e74cc0c67e147f8e9435f04b366e99822329a48383e1a318e4581bafa
spent
true